Which course should I choose?

Treetop Zoofari Course

  • 54″ +
  • 8 years +
  • 2-3 hours long
  • 250lb max weight limit
  • Chaperone may be required (see Chaperone rules below)

The Treetop Zoofari is the largest and most involved course located at the Park and as long as you are at least 54″ tall and 8 years old you can experience the thrill.  Treetop Zoofari is designed for the entire family.  As you traverse the canopy walk plus multiple high stakes challenges and large zip lines at 40 feet above the ground there will be choices given along the route.  These choices are the difference between easier and more challenging routes.  Fly more than 600 feet across the zoo’s lake and zip by tapirs, rheas, and toucans. This course takes between 2-3 hours to complete depending on your skill set, time of day, and how busy the course might be. Last admission is 3:30 pm.

Junior Explorer Course

  • 40″+
  • 4 years +
  • 40 – 60 minutes long
  • 250lb max weight limit
  • Chaperone may be required (see Chaperone rules below)

Young adventurers will travel through the trees as they pass over tightropes, Indiana Jones bridges, through barrels, and nets only to top off their adventure with a 60 foot zip line.   The challenges are all tree to tree and range from 5-12 feet in the air.   This course takes at least 45 minutes to complete. Last admission is 4:00 pm.

What are the chaperone rules?

Treetop Zoofari Course

  • Participating chaperone required for ages 8-15
  • Chaperone is anyone ages 18+
  • Chaperone/Child ratio is 1:5
  • Participants ages 16-17 must have chaperone on zoo premise

Junior Explorer Course

  • Participating Chaperone required for ages 4-6
    •  Chaperone is anyone ages 18+
    •  Ages 12+ may be a participating Chaperone if parent designated and parent is present on Junior course grounds
    •  Chaperone/Child ratio is 1:3
  • Walking Chaperone required for ages 7-15
    • Chaperone is anyone ages 18+
    •  Chaperone/Child ratio is 1:5
    • Free

 Course Rules

  • ALL participants must complete and sign a waiver release agreement Sign a Waiver online 
  • Participants under 18 years old must have their waiver completed and signed by their parent or legal guardian Sign a Waiver online 
  • Participants must pass a training session before being permitted to begin any course
  • No participants permitted to begin any course without proper safety equipment
  • Participants must be securely clipped into the red safety line at all times
  • Participants must follow all directions from Treetop Zoofari staff
  • No horseplay (ex: jumping, bouncing on the course)
  • Taunting of animals, zoo guests, or other participants is strictly prohibited

Safety Regulations

  • Violating any course rules or safety regulations will result in removal from courses
  • Both courses are physically challenging and weather can be extreme
  • Drink plenty of water prior to beginning, there is also two water stations located along our Treetop Zoofari Course
  • PREGNANT women are strictly prohibited from going on any of the courses
  • In the event of severe weather, follow all directions from Treetop Zoofari staff for safe evacuation
  • Take your time on the course, we want you to have a fun, safe, and rewarding visit
  • At any point on the course, participants have the option to ask Treetop Zoofari staff to get them down
